Slightly overhyped but still good brushes. I think they apply makeup nicely regardless of the product. The favorites are 114 Tapered Blush, 115 Round Kabuki, and 112 Angled Kabuki. All the brushes can feel a bit scratchy at first, even after washing.
My biggest complaint is 111 Powder Deluxe. A really bad powder brush in my opinion. It’s way too big, even for powder bronzer, and doesn’t get under the eyes without caking everything. Since it’s so big, it doesn’t handle loose powder well at all. The only thing it’s good for is sweeping powder all over the face, but since it’s a bit pointy, I don’t even think it’s particularly good for that.
I haven’t found a good use for 119 Multi Highlight. It sticks out the most of all the brushes and feels the most unnecessary since the other brushes can be used for highlighter, or it works even better with the finger.
